BeebEm is a BBC Micro and BBC Master 128 Emulator.


Quote:
Version 3.0 (Mike Wyatt)
-----------
* Improved VIA timing emulation and fixed some instruction cycle counts.
Its still not perfect but its good enough to run various versions of the
infamous "Kevin Edwards" protection code! The following tapes now load
and run:
Knight Lore, Alien 8, Daley Thompson Supertest, Strykers Run,
Exile, Joust, Galaforce
These are the only ones I´ve tried, others may work as well.
* Fixed bug in horizontal displayed register emulation. Joust tape loading
screen now appears centered correctly.
* Fixed bug in virtical sync position register emulation. Stops DirectX
errors occurring when running Micropower Roulette.
* Fixed bug in virtical displayed/total register emulation for mode 7.
Screen is now cleared below lines that are displayed.
* Added AVI video capture to the file menu (now with resolution and frame
skip options).
* Changed command line parsing so it works when paths are enclosed in
quotes and it now supports loading of UEF state files (thanks to Jasper
for this one). Disk and state files can now be associated with BeebEm
and run by double clicking on them.
* Fixed bug in IDE hard disk file access that prevented BeebEm from running
when logged in as an unprivileged user on Windows XP.
* Fixed bug with window positioning when task bar is on left or top of
screen.
* Bumped version to 3.0 to keep in sync with the Mac version of BeebEm.
